What does it mean to take my yoke?
In addition to its literal meaning, the concept of a yoke also appears in many scriptures as a metaphor for bondage or servitude; see Jeremiah 28:2; Alma 44:2.) What does it mean to take Christ’s yoke upon us? (To humbly do his will and allow him to guide and direct our lives.)
Where does Jesus say my yoke is easy?
Matthew 11: 28 ¶ Come unto me, all ye that labour and are heavy laden, and I will give you rest. 29 Take my yoke upon you, and learn of me; for I am meek and lowly in heart: and ye shall find rest unto your souls. 30 For my yoke is easy, and my burden is light.

Why did Jesus say learn of me?
The second meaning of “learn of me” is: Learn from me. The Lord Jesus Christ knows exactly what we need. His knowledge and understanding, His intelligence and His character, are all perfect, complete. As we immerse ourselves in the scriptures, we learn from His perfect example.
What is Matthew chapter 11 all about?
Jesus, John, and Some Sinful Cities
Then Jesus starts preaching about John the Baptist. Well, more like singing his praises. Jesus calls John “more than a prophet” (11:9) and compares their generation to children who don’t dance when music is playing or don’t mourn when there is wailing.

What does Jesus mean by rest?
Rest is defined as “peace, ease or refreshment.” the Bible speaks quite highly of rest. Its repeated all throughout Scripture, beginning with the creation story in Genesis 1 and 2. We see that God created for six days straight and then he rested on the seventh.
